Questions about Emergency Dentists

What does an emergency dentist do?

An emergency dentist is capable of treating emergency dental situations. They allow walk-in patients so they can receive fast and effective treatment for their dental emergencies.

Regular dentists usually require you to schedule an appointment before your procedure. However, emergency dentists are trained to handle emergencies to provide quick and immediate care.

What is a dental emergency?

A dental emergency is when you experience severe dental pain that affects your life. These may include the following:

  • Uncontrollable dental hemorrhage following extractions
  • Rapidly increasing swelling around the throat or eye
  • Trauma confined to the dental arches

How soon can I expect to be seen by an emergency dentist?

You can see an emergency dentist right away. If your condition is classified as an emergency, it’s okay not to see your regular dentist. Visiting an emergency dentist is the best course of action.

You may also go to the emergency room for an emergency dental procedure. However, most emergency rooms don’t have enough equipment to handle all types of emergencies. 

What types of dental emergencies can be treated on the same day?

Here are some dental emergencies that can be treated on the same day:

  • Toothaches
  • Chipped tooth
  • Dental abscess
  • Dental restorations
  • Tooth filling 
  • Dental crown repairs
  • Objects stuck between the teeth
  • Soft tissue injuries

How much will emergency dental treatment cost?

The cost of your treatment will depend on the procedure. Here’s how much you can expect to pay:

  • Root canal – $700 to $1,200
  • Fills – $110 to $240
  • Tooth extraction – $75 to $300
  • Dental crowns – $1,000 to $1,500

Is a toothache a dental emergency?

A toothache can be considered a dental emergency if it severely affects your life. Toothaches that result from injury or an accident are dental emergencies.

If the pain is unbearable, immediately seek an emergency dentist for treatment.
